Oil prices have risen slightly due to concerns over tighter global supply amid U.S. threats of tariffs on Venezuelan oil buyers. Additionally, the announcement of a new 25% tariff on imported cars could impact oil demand. Analysts suggest the tariffs might slow the transition to more fuel-efficient vehicles.
